In this episode of REL & Friends, REL sits down with Ray Herrera, a New York-based architecture and design professional. In another life, he was the Art Director for the Brooklyn Hip Hop Festival and was the Creative Director for the blog-era staple The Couch Sessions. Today, he's a project manager at MKDA, corporate planning and interior design recognized by Interior Design magazine as one of the industry's Top 100 Interior Design Giants.

In this conversation, REL and Ray talk about growing up in Puerto Rico in the 80's, how he got involved with the Brooklyn Hip Hop Festival and the New York creative scene, and the importance of prioritizing sleep.
